<h2>Positive and Negative Numbers on the Number Line</h2>

When we add two negative numbers, the result will be negative.

When we add a negative and a positive number, the result can be positive, negative, or equal to zero.

  • Take the absolute values of both numbers (disregard their signs). If the number that was positive is greater, then the result will be positive.
  • If the number that was negative is greater, then the result will be negative.
  • If the two numbers are equal, then the result will be 0.

When we add two positive numbers, the result will be positive.
